Review of Coco (2017) by Andrew H — 03 Jan 2018
Is this a remake of Book of Life? It looks and sounds the same, and have the same theme of Mexican legends and a trip to the land of the dead. Its not really a remake, as the basic story is different, but it definitely is a sister movie that build on the success of the previous movie.
Its also made by a different studio, but its still relies heavily on the same pallet. What it does better is to anchor it more firmly into Mexican culture and traditions by focusing on the value of family.
It highlights and utilizes the good side of Americans duality relationship towards Mexico. It is also an excellent family movie, as it really is a movie about family made for every member of the family.
